Bryn Mawr, PA, is a delightful blend of suburban tranquility and urban convenience, characterized by its beautiful tree-lined streets and well-maintained parks. The expansive Bryn Mawr Park offers playgrounds, sports fields, and scenic walking trails, perfect for leisurely strolls or family outings. Nearby, Freedom Playground and The Willows Park provide additional green spaces for relaxation and recreation, while the Haverford Reserve Dog Park is a favorite among pet owners.
A vibrant community atmosphere thrives here, with a variety of rental options ranging from cozy apartments to spacious townhomes, often just a short walk from local shops and eateries. Culinary delights abound, with popular spots similar to Coyote Crossing and White Dog Cafe Wayne offering diverse dining experiences. For a quick treat, Krispy Kreme and Gryphon Cafe are perfect for coffee and pastries, while Minella's Diner serves up classic comfort food.
Cultural enrichment is easily accessible, thanks to the presence of Bryn Mawr College, which not only enhances the academic vibe but also hosts a range of cultural events throughout the year. The Frances M. Maguire Art Museum at Saint Joseph's University and the Grange Estate provide opportunities to explore art and history, while the Newtown Square Historical Society & Paper Mill House Museum offers a glimpse into the area's past.
Shopping enthusiasts will find plenty to explore at nearby shopping centers similar to Suburban Square and Wynnewood Shopping Center, where a mix of boutiques and larger retailers cater to diverse tastes. Community events, such as the Bryn Mawr Film Institute's screenings and the annual Bryn Mawr Farmers Market, foster connections among residents and support local vendors.
With its rich history, welcoming environment, and easy access to public transportation for commutes to nearby Philadelphia, Bryn Mawr stands out as an inviting place to call home, where every day offers new opportunities for exploration and enjoyment.
The average rent in Bryn Mawr, PA is $1,806.
The average rent for a 1 bedroom apartment in Bryn Mawr, PA is $1,806.
The average rent for a 2 bedroom apartment in Bryn Mawr, PA is $2,566.
The average rent for a 3 bedroom apartment in Bryn Mawr, PA is $2,917.
The average rent for a 4 bedroom apartment in Bryn Mawr, PA is $2,975.
